I was wondering if there is any full scale lightsabers without blade. Something as good looking as the Master Replicas Force FX line. The problem is that you can not remove the blade from the Force FX lightsabers and the Limited Edtitions are way too expensive.
post #109 of 485
Sam,

As far as I know Master Replicas is the only company making full scale lightsaber replicas, but as you already know most of them are Limited Editions and quite expensive. The Count Dooku I purchased yesterday is numbered out of only 3500 and it was probably more than I should have spent, but I couldn't help it. I just LOVE the design of his saber and I had to have one for my collection.
post #110 of 485
Sam,

I think MR has pretty much cornered the market on the full scale prop replicas for LucasFilm. While they are spendy, when one looks at the craftsmanship, they seem worth it...I feel like I have a movie prop when I hold my DV: EPIV limited saber.

From what I understand, there is some funky way to remove the blade from the FX line sabers. But the reason the FX line is cheaper is because they had to modify the replicas slightly to allow for batteries and such.

In fact, I remember someone being pissed at a scam on eBay because a guy claimed to be selling a LE saber, and it was just one of the FX versions with the blade removed.
